技术文摘
npm 包的发布、更新及相关注意事项(以发布 vue 插件为例)
npm 包的发布、更新及相关注意事项(以发布 vue 插件为例)
在前端开发领域,npm 包的发布和更新是非常重要的环节。通过发布自己开发的 npm 包,可以方便地与其他开发者共享代码,提高开发效率。下面以发布 vue 插件为例,来介绍 npm 包的发布、更新及相关注意事项。
要确保你的 vue 插件代码已经编写完成,并且结构清晰、功能完善。在代码的根目录下,创建一个 package.json 文件,用于描述包的相关信息,如名称、版本、描述、作者、依赖等。
在发布之前,需要登录 npm 账号。如果没有账号,可以在 npm 官网上注册一个。登录成功后,在终端中执行 npm publish 命令,即可将包发布到 npm 上。
当需要更新 npm 包时,需要修改 package.json 文件中的版本号。遵循语义化版本控制规范,如主版本号、次版本号、补丁版本号的递增规则,清晰地传达更新的内容和重要性。
更新代码后,再次执行 npm publish 命令,新的版本就会发布到 npm 上。
在发布和更新 npm 包时,有几个注意事项。一是要确保代码的质量和稳定性,进行充分的测试,避免出现严重的 bug。二是要提供清晰的文档,说明包的使用方法、参数、示例等,方便其他开发者使用。三是要注意包的大小,尽量优化和压缩代码,减少不必要的依赖,提高下载和使用的效率。
另外,对于 vue 插件,还需要考虑与不同版本 vue 的兼容性。在文档中明确说明支持的 vue 版本范围,以及可能存在的兼容性问题和解决方案。
发布和更新 npm 包需要认真对待,遵循相关规范和注意事项,为开发者提供高质量、易用的代码包。希望通过以上介绍,能让您在发布和更新 npm 包(特别是 vue 插件)的过程中更加顺利。
- 深入剖析 C++ 中死锁现象的根源
- C++内存管理:由基础至高级的奥秘
- Python 中 zoneinfo 模块的使用方法
- 同事的策略模式为何比我高级这么多?我究竟差在哪?
- Kubernetes 弃用 API 的管理:卓越实践与工具
- Python 办公利器:Python 批量查找 Excel 数据之法
- Vue3 中五个超实用工具,近期项目频繁使用!
- C++异常处理深度探究:打造健壮程序的法宝
- 15 个接口性能优化技巧
- 五个提升效率的 JavaScript 实用程序库
- 基于 Taro 构建小程序多项目架构
- VS Code 内置的五大必备神器功能,提升编程效率!
- 查电影评分别指望互联网
- Python 中的 YAML 解析:PyYAML 全面解读
- JDK19 新特性虚拟线程究竟是什么